Dropping Toledo in at No. 10 implied that we’re leaving Navy out of this list. The one thing that really put Toledo over the edge for me was their early season win over Arkansas, on the road.

While Navy did have a win at Memphis, and I was a huge fan of Memphis and Paxton Lynch when they were hot, Toledo still has the edge to me. While Navy has a tougher schedule, ranked 62nd compared to Toledo at 75th, it’s also hard for me to get behind a triple option attack, especially if you were to put them up against some of these premier defenses included in this list.

So while it might not necessarily be me totally buying into Toledo, rather me just not buying Navy, to give Toledo the 10 spot and show them some love.
